
Kelsey Mitchell’s outstanding display against the Connecticut Sun on Sunday earned high praise from Indiana Fever star Caitlin Clark. Mitchell scored 34 of her career-best 38 points in the second half and overtime, helping the Fever secure a 99-93 victory. After the game, Clark expressed her admiration for Mitchell’s efforts, emphasizing the strength of their team bond.

Caitlin Clark Continues to Show Leadership Despite Injury Absence
Clark has missed 13 straight games due to injury but remains a vital presence for the Indiana Fever off the court. Though she did not travel to Connecticut for the matchup against the Sun, Clark stayed fully engaged, supporting her team vocally from sidelines and tracking every moment of the contest. The Fever organization chose to keep Clark in Indiana to allow her extra days of rest before the next challenging series.

The team’s upcoming focus is a home-and-away series against the Minnesota Lynx, who currently hold the best record in the WNBA. Reports indicate Clark is intensifying her workout regimen to return stronger and support Mitchell and the rest of the squad in upcoming contests.
